About Testament Music Video Director: Thomas Mignone

"There's a new independent feature film that's coming out in June called On The Doll --- the film's director is our friend and video director Thomas Mignone. Besides just directing our new video for 'More Than Meets The Eye', he's directed lots of other videos you may know, such as MUDVAYNE's 'Dig', and bands like SLIPKNOT, DEATH ANGEL, SYSTEM OF A DOWN, SEPULTURA, SOULFLY, OBITUARY, DANZIG, MEGADETH, THE FALL OF TROY, and many others.

The film stars Brittany Snow in a way you've never seen her before --- she plays a very mean-spirited prostitute who exacts revenge on the people who have abused and exploited her. The film deals with themes of child abuse and the way people can be victimized in a very compelling and heartfelt way --- the film also stars Candice Accola from Juno, and Josh Janowicz from The Chumscrubber.

The title comes On The Doll comes from the phrase psychiatrists ask children who've been abused to 'Show them on the doll where they were touched.' All the characters in this film are very strong, independent-thinking people who find ways to help each other overcome their adversaries even though they have all experienced great pain and hurt in their younger lives but they can still find the strength to not be victimized throughout their adult lives.

The film also has some great music in it too. The soundtrack is by Paul D'Amour, who was the original bassist and songwriter for TOOL. There are also songs by MISS DERRINGER, THE CRYSTAL METHOD, FEERSUM ENNJIN and THE BLACK HEART PROCESSION. The music in the film is like a character itself and really creates the somber mood.
